2.0 Introduction Hybrid Power System This is a multifunctional off grid solar inverter, integrated with a MPPT solar charge controller, a high frequency pure sine wave inverter and a UPS function module in one machine, which is perfect for off grid backup power and self-consumption applications.

3.4 AC Input/Output Connection CAUTION!! Before connecting to AC input power source, please install a separate AC breaker between inverter and AC input power source. This will ensure the inverter can be securely disconnected during maintenance and fully protected from over current of AC input. The recommended spec of AC breaker is 32A for 3KVA, 50A for 5KVA.

4.2.2 LCD Setting After pressing and holding ENTER button for 3 seconds, the unit will enter setting mode. Press “UP” or “DOWN” button to select setting programs. Then press “ENTER” button to confirm the selection or ESC button to exit. Program Description Setting Option...

Saving mode disable (default) If disabled, no matter connected load is low or high, the on/off status of inverter output will not be effected. Power saving mode enable/disable Saving mode enable If enabled, the output of inverter will be off when connected load is pretty low or not detected.

5.0 Parallel Installation Guide 5.1 Introduction This inverter can be used in parallel with two different operation modes. 1. Parallel operation in single phase with up to 6 units. 2. Maximum 6 units work together to support 3-phase equipment. Four units support one phase maximum. NOTE: If the package includes share current cable and parallel cable, the inverter is default supported parallel operation.
